§ 4984. County tax transmitted to supervisor

When a county tax is assessed in Essex county, the county treasurer shall transmit to the supervisor for the unorganized towns and gores within Essex county a certified statement of the amount of such tax based on the grand list of such unorganized towns and gores as shown by the list filed annually under the provisions of section 4303 of this title. The supervisor shall thereupon issue his warrant in favor of Essex county for the amount of such tax out of the funds received by him from the tax levied under the provisions of section 4981 of this title. (Added 1967, No. 331 (Adj. Sess.), § 3, eff. Jan. 1, 1969.)
